.hero-xl{position:relative;padding:110px 24px 56px}.hero-xl h1{font-size:clamp(40px,7vw,78px);line-height:1.05;letter-spacing:-.02em;margin:0 0 8px;font-weight:800}.hero-xl p{font-size:clamp(16px,2.2vw,20px);color:#fff;margin:0 0 24px}.hero-orb,.hero-orb2{position:absolute;filter:blur(48px);z-index:-1;opacity:.6;border-radius:50%;transform:translateZ(0)}.hero-orb{width:460px;height:460px;left:-140px;top:-120px;background:radial-gradient(closest-side,rgba(var(--accent-soft-rgb),.45),transparent 70%)}.hero-orb2{width:460px;height:460px;right:-140px;top:20px;background:radial-gradient(closest-side,rgba(var(--accent-soft-rgb),.28),transparent 70%)}.uspbar{display:flex;gap:16px;flex-wrap:wrap;justify-content:center;color:#5c5c5c;font-size:14px}.category-grid{margin-top:16px}.category-card{position:relative;display:block;min-height:160px;padding:22px;background:linear-gradient(180deg,#ffffffe6 0,#ffffffb3);color:#111}.category-card .title{font-weight:800;font-size:22px;margin:0 0 6px}.category-card .desc{color:#262626;margin:0;opacity:.85}.category-card .tag{position:absolute;top:16px;right:16px;font-size:12px;letter-spacing:.2em;text-transform:uppercase;background:rgba(var(--accent-rgb),.14);color:#5c4b18;padding:6px 10px;border-radius:999px}.why .lead{font-weight:700;font-size:18px}.checks{list-style:none;margin:0;padding:0}.checks li{margin:8px 0;position:relative;padding-left:26px}.checks li:before{content:"\2713";position:absolute;left:0;top:0;width:20px;height:20px;display:flex;align-items:center;justify-content:center;font-size:12px;color:#5c4b18;background:rgba(var(--accent-rgb),.25);border-radius:50%}.pill-list{display:flex;gap:8px;flex-wrap:wrap}.pill{padding:8px 12px;border-radius:999px;border:1px solid rgba(0,0,0,.1);background:#fff9;font-weight:600}.trust{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:8px}.trust-item{background:rgba(var(--accent-rgb),.12);border:1px solid rgba(var(--accent-rgb),.25);padding:10px 12px;border-radius:12px;font-weight:600}.grid-head{display:flex;align-items:flex-end;justify-content:space-between}.link{opacity:.8;text-decoration:underline}.product img{width:100%;height:auto;display:block}.product-title{font-weight:700;margin-bottom:6px}.price{font-size:16px}.story{margin-top:56px}.story-media{min-height:360px;background-size:cover;background-position:center}.story p{color:#2a2a2a}.story-bullets{padding-left:20px}.story-bullets li{margin:6px 0}.cta{text-align:center;padding:40px 24px}.nl-form{display:flex;gap:12px;justify-content:center;flex-wrap:wrap}.nl-input{padding:14px 16px;border-radius:999px;border:1px solid rgba(0,0,0,.12);min-width:280px}.nl-btn{padding:14px 22px}.opening-promo{position:relative;isolation:isolate;overflow:hidden;padding:28px 0}.opening-promo: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,#ffffffd9,#ffffffb3);z-index:-2}.op-beam{position:absolute;left:-10vw;right:-10vw;top:0;height:200px;background:linear-gradient(90deg,rgba(var(--accent-rgb),.35),rgba(var(--accent-rgb),.16));transform:skewY(-4deg);filter:saturate(140%);z-index:-1}.op-sparkle,.op-sparkle2{position:absolute;border-radius:50%;filter:blur(26px);opacity:.6;animation:opFloat 9s ease-in-out infinite}.op-sparkle{width:260px;height:260px;top:-60px;right:2vw;background:radial-gradient(closest-side,rgba(var(--accent-soft-rgb),.55),transparent 70%)}.op-sparkle2{width:220px;height:220px;bottom:-40px;left:2vw;background:radial-gradient(closest-side,rgba(var(--accent-soft-rgb),.35),transparent 70%);animation-duration:11s}.op-ring{position:absolute;right:8vw;top:30px;width:160px;height:160px;border-radius:50%;background:conic-gradient(from 0deg,#0000 0 65%,rgba(var(--accent-rgb),.4) 65% 75%,#0000 75% 100%);filter:blur(.3px);animation:opSpin 14s linear infinite;opacity:.6}.op-dots{position:absolute;left:6vw;bottom:16px;width:180px;height:100px;background-image:radial-gradient(rgba(0,0,0,.08) 1px,transparent 1px);background-size:12px 12px;opacity:.5;transform:skewY(-4deg)}.op-inner{display:flex;align-items:center;justify-content:space-between;gap:18px}.op-left{display:flex;align-items:center;gap:16px;min-width:0}.op-badge{display:inline-flex;align-items:center;justify-content:center;min-width:88px;height:88px;border-radius:24px;background:linear-gradient(180deg,var(--accent),var(--accent-2));box-shadow:0 12px 28px rgba(var(--accent-rgb),.35);font-weight:900;font-size:28px;color:#1b1b1b}.op-texts{display:flex;flex-direction:column;gap:4px;min-width:0}.op-title{font-size:clamp(20px,2.6vw,30px);font-weight:900;letter-spacing:-.01em}.op-lead{margin:0;font-weight:700}.op-small{margin:0;font-size:13px;opacity:.75}.op-right{flex:0 0 auto}.op-cta{padding:14px 24px;border-radius:999px}@keyframes opFloat{0%{transform:translateY(0)}50%{transform:translateY(10px)}to{transform:translateY(0)}}@keyframes opSpin{to{transform:rotate(360deg)}}@media (max-width:900px){.opening-promo{padding:22px 0}.op-inner{flex-direction:column;align-items:stretch;gap:12px}.op-left{gap:12px}.op-badge{min-width:72px;height:72px;font-size:24px;border-radius:20px}.op-cta{width:100%}.op-beam{height:150px}}@media (max-width:600px){.opening-promo{padding:20px 0}.op-inner{gap:12px;align-items:center}.op-left{flex-direction:column;align-items:center;text-align:center;gap:10px}.op-texts{align-items:center}.op-title{font-size:22px}.op-lead{font-size:15px;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.op-small{font-size:12px}.op-badge{min-width:68px;height:68px;font-size:22px;border-radius:18px}.op-cta{width:100%;padding:14px 18px}.op-beam{height:120px}.op-ring,.op-dots{display:none}.op-sparkle{width:180px;height:180px;top:-40px;right:-20px}.op-sparkle2{width:160px;height:160px;bottom:-40px;left:-20px}}@media (max-width:380px){.opening-promo{padding:16px 0}.op-badge{min-width:60px;height:60px;font-size:20px;border-radius:16px}.op-title{font-size:20px}.op-cta{padding:12px 16px}}
/*# sourceMappingURL=/cdn/shop/t/11/assets/04-home.css.map */
